The journey from Maclean to Townsville covers approximately 1,500 kilometers along the Queensland coast. Driving via the Bruce Highway is the most common route, taking about 18 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Brisbane to Townsville after traveling from Maclean to Brisbane by bus. Townsville is a major hub for the Great Barrier Reef and Magnetic Island. The route passes through major cities like Brisbane, Rockhampton, and Mackay.
Total Distance: Driving distance 1,500 km, straight-line air distance 1,250 km.
